vim без номера строки в окне taglist - PullRequest
7 голосов
/ 23 сентября 2010

Я недавно установил параметр

set relativenumber

в моем .vimrc, но теперь, когда я открываю taglist или NerdTree, эти буферы имеют номера строк.Есть ли способ отключить номера строк в буферах taglist и nerdtree (но оставить их в других)?

1 Ответ

9 голосов
/ 23 сентября 2010

Буферы NERDTree и TagList имеют определенные типы файлов, которые помогают отличать их от других буферов.Это особенно полезно в авто-командах, так как можно выполнять команду всякий раз, когда тип файла буфера изменяется на конкретное значение.

В этом случае нам нужно отключить relativenumberопция всякий раз, когда тип файла буфера nerdtree или taglist:

:autocmd FileType nerdtree set norelativenumber
:autocmd FileType taglist set norelativenumber

(Обратите внимание, что опция relativenumber является локальной для буфера и, следовательно, переключается только в текущем буферепо умолчанию.)

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...